You may hear the protest chant, “what do we want? Land rights!” —but what does it really mean? Land is at the heart of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ander identity, culture, and wellbeing. Known as “Country,” it includes land, waterways, skies, and all living things. In this episode of Australia Explained, we explore Indigenous land rights—what they involve, which land is covered, who can make claims, and the impact on First Nati...

At some stage you will probably need help from a Justice of the Peace. It may be to prove your identity, to make an insurance claim or to certify copies of your legal documents in your language. JPs are trained volunteers who play a crucial role in the community by helping maintain the integrity of our legal system. So what exactly does a JP do and where can we find one when we need their services? - Pada tahap tertentu Anda mungki...

Did you know that people offering taxi services from home need to register for Goods and Services Tax (GST)—regardless of how much they earn? Or that a fitness instructor needs local council approval to see clients at home? In this episode, we unpack the basic rules you need to know when setting up a home-based business in Australia. - Tahukah Anda bahwa orang yang menawarkan layanan taksi dari rumah perlu mendaftar untuk Pajak Bar...

In Australia, alcohol is often portrayed as part of social life—especially at BBQs, sporting events, and public holidays. Customs like BYO, where you bring your own drinks to gatherings, and 'shouting' rounds at the pub are part of the culture. However, because of the health risks associated with alcohol, there are regulations in place. It’s also important to understand the laws around the legal drinking age, where you can buy or c...

A free, independent and diverse press is a fundamental pillar of democracy. Australia has two taxpayer-funded networks that serve the public interest (ABC and SBS), plus a variety of commercial and community media outlets. Although publicly funded media receives money from the government, it is unlike the state-sponsored outlets found overseas. - Pers yang bebas, independen dan beragam adalah pilar fundamental demokrasi. Australia has one of the highest life expectancies in the world. On average, Australians live to see their 83rd birthday. But for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ples, life expectancy is about eight years less. Closing the Gap is a national agreement designed to change that. By improving the health and wellbeing of First Nations, they can enjoy the same quality of life and opportunities as non-Indigenous Australians. - Aus...
